"Plant based kissa" restaurant that's part of the Komeda chain of coffee shops and is certified vegan by the Japan Vegan Society. Serves coffee drinks and a 34-item food menu with 8 desserts. Last order 9:30pm. Location is 2 minutes from Higashi-Ginza station. Est. 2020. Open Mon-Sun 7:00am-7:30pm. Last order 9.30pm.

Komeda is is a vegan, cafe in Chuo offering Burgers, Sandwiches, Toasts and a bunch of sweet stuff. Each seat has a Tablet for easy ordering in English.
Read moreWhat I ate:
- Soy Ham Cutlet Sandwich
- mixed plate of fries and Tofu fritters
The food was done pretty quickly which was good since I was famished. First of the Fries and the Fritters. Pretty much exactly what I expected. Crunchy and salty goodness w/ ketchup and tartar sauce.
I was way more excited for the Soy Ham Cutlet Sandwich. It's a dish I've seen in many cafes and conbinis here so I was excited to finally have found a vegan version. And damn it was good. Inside toasted sandwich bread I found caramelized onions and paprika, paired w/ pickled cabbage and the main star of the show: vegan crispy soy ham cutlets. All of that was topped w/ a sweet miso sauce and I was given a spicy mayo to dip the whole thing in. This was a-mazing. The saltiness and crunch of the cutlet, the sweetness and spiceyness of the miso and vegan mayo and the crunch from the onions, paprika and cabbage, all these flavors and textures worked beautifully together.
This was some delightful guilty pleasure vegan junk food. Which was especially good after eating in a lot of healthy, organic vegan restaurants for the past few days. But I personally think it was maybe a little too pricey for "just" sandwiches and fries. Either way give it a try when your nearby.

This really cute restaurant has a morning service, where you order coffee and get a toast with it. The toast is covered in vegan butter and you can choose something else with it (vegan Creme cheese or jam). They also have other things like pancakes, which were also good!
Read moreYou order via a tablet, which you can use in English.
